Bug Description

Binary package hint: xserver-xorg-core

I have tried to upgrade from version 1:1.0.2-0ubuntu10.1 to 1:1.0.2-0ubuntu10.3. After the upgrade I logged out and killed the xserver (ctrl-alt-backspace) to use the new package. I was informed that starting the xserver failed (no screens found). I use the nvidia module so I replaced that one with the OS module nv in the xorg.conf. No difference.
When I downgraded to 10.1 it worked again.

I will repeat this and send the Xorg.log ASAP.

My system is AMD64 based
